I'm really hoping we make the 7th seed now. Boston has KG ailing, and he may not be healthy even for the playoffs. If Boston falls back because of that then we get Orlando whom most people wanted out of the big 3.

It will be interesting to see how the team plays over the final 6 games. The health of John Salmons will probably be key. At least the three days off came at a good time in that regard to let everyone rest up for the stretch run.

The Detroit game will determine whether we can get the 7th seed, and the Charlotte game will at least partially determine whether we beat Charlotte or not. I think we can beat Charlotte even without winning that game, while I think we need the win at Detroit to get 7th.

Either way, hard to view the Bulls as Cinderella. We'd need to present some threat of winning a series for that to happen. Instead we'll be joked about and mocked by Barkley in every pre-game as a team that sucks and they'll complain about how many bad teams they let into the playoffs.
